4

我想使用 JavaME (MIDP/CLDC) 为手机编写一个小数据输入应用程序。如何最好地将数据与我 PC 上的本地应用程序同步(分别将数据传输到 PC)?如果手机是通过 USB 电缆插入的,是否有任何标准方法可以连接到 PC?

我知道我可以连接到一些 Web 服务,但我不想使用设备的互联网连接。

该应用程序应该在尽可能多的设备上运行(当然),但对于某些特定设备的提示也将不胜感激......

对不起,如果这个问题有点笼统,但我是 JavaME 编程的新手,我没有在网上找到任何关于这个主题的好资源......

4

2 回答 2

2

诺基亚 Series60 设备应该有一个 javax.microedition.io.CommConnection 允许通过通用 GCF API 使用 USB、红外线和/或蓝牙通信端口。

如果您想要在大多数支持蓝牙的手机上工作的东西,可以使用 JSR-82 进行数据传输。该规范位于http://www.jcp.org/en/jsr/detail?id=82

于 2009-09-03T16:14:15.097 回答
0

一种方法是使用文件连接 API 将数据保存在预定位置。然后,同步工作将完全由 PC 应用程序完成,该应用程序扫描设备上是否存在特定文件夹。如果发现它可以将新数据写入文件夹,或从中读取更改的数据,J2ME 应用程序会在下次启动时拾取这两个活动。

于 2009-08-31T12:11:34.480 回答